Definitions
- the invention relates to a footwear element comprising an outer sole and a flexible upper, as well as points that protrude at an outer face of the outer sole.
- the footwear element is intended to house a shoe, including sports.
- the invention also relates to an assembly comprising the shoe and the footwear element.
- the footwear element as well as the shoe, can be used in areas such as walking or running flat or mountain, mountaineering, or climbing.
- the shoe is known per se. It includes an outer sole and a flexible shaft, which allows a user to walk, run, or practice a sport in the usual conditions, that is to say sometimes on dry land, or sometimes on land wet, wet, or even snowy or muddy. Walking, running or playing a sport is difficult or even dangerous when the terrain is degraded or naturally difficult. This is particularly the case for soils made slippery for example because of mud, snow, ice, or other. To cope with situations such as those mentioned above, it is known to cover the shoe with a footwear element, which is precisely designed to facilitate walking, running or playing a sport on difficult terrain.
- a footwear element comprises an outer sole and a flexible rod, as well as points that protrude at an outer face of the outer sole.
- the flexible upper of the footwear element comprises a lower portion intended to cover the boot. It is observed that according to the document US 5,600,901 , the flexible upper of the footwear element has a boot opening, to allow its establishment on the shoe.
- the footwear element by the points it carries, allows the user to walk, or to practice golf on degraded or naturally difficult terrain.
- the use of a footwear element according to the document US 5,600,901 does not always give complete satisfaction, and is limited to a walking use.
- the tips make walking, running or practicing an easier sport with regard for example to the ground adhesion, the precision of the supports or the transmission of the sensory information, one realizes that the the user is still embarrassed under extreme conditions. This is the case on very wet ground where water enters the footwear and the shoe. This is also the case in snow or on icy ground, with this time penetration of snow or ice crystals in the footwear and the shoe, or covering the ankle or even the lower leg, by the snow or ice cream. In fact the user is not protected against intrusions of foreign bodies, or against thermal aggressions, especially against cold, in the ankle and lower leg.
- the general object of the invention is the improvement of a footwear element provided with spikes. More specifically, the invention seeks to reduce or eliminate the inconvenience caused by water, snow or ice, as well as the inconvenience resulting from difficult thermal, especially cold. In other words, it is a question of improving the comfort of the footwear element.
- An additional object of the invention is to improve the adhesion to the ground, the accuracy of the supports or the transmission of sensory information.
- the invention proposes a footwear element comprising an outer sole and a flexible upper, as well as points that project at an outer face of the outer sole, the flexible upper comprising a lower portion intended to cover the foot. of a user, the flexible rod having a boot opening.
- the footwear element according to the invention is characterized in that the upper comprises a high portion that extends the lower portion in a direction away from the outer sole, the upper portion being provided to cover at least the ankle of the user , or the ankle and part of the lower leg.
- the upper portion of the upper increases the outer surface of the footwear element relative to an element according to the prior art. It can also be said that the upper portion of the upper increases the amount of footwear and protection offered by the footwear element according to the invention.
- the specific properties of the lower portion of the rod such as watertightness or thermal insulation, are extended to the upper portion. That is to say that in addition to the foot, the ankle or together the ankle and part of the lower leg are protected. This improves the footwear element. Water, snow or ice can not penetrate, or can much more difficult, inside the footwear element.
- the shoe and the foot are thus preserved against intrusions of foreign bodies, or against thermal aggressions, especially against the cold, at the level of the ankle and the lower leg.
- the best wrapping of the foot and ankle also increases the proprioceptive perceptions, and thus improve the stability of the user.
- the upper portion of the footwear element also reinforces the maintenance of its outer sole against the outer sole of the shoe. This advantageously results in greater stability of the tips, and therefore better adhesion to the ground, and greater accuracy of support or transmission of sensory information.
- the first embodiment that will be described after more specifically relates to a footwear element for walking or running on snow or ice, or for climbing in ice cascades.
- the invention applies to other fields such as those mentioned before.
- a footwear element 1 is provided to accommodate a walking shoe or race 2, itself intended to accommodate the foot of the user.
- the footwear element 1 comprises an outer sole 3 and a flexible upper 4.
- the footwear element extends in length from a rear end or heel 5 to a front end or tip 6, and in width between a lateral part 7 and a medial part 8.
- the footwear element 1 also comprises spikes 9 which protrude at an outer face 10 of the outer sole 3.
- the implantation of the spikes 9 will be detailed later, although it can already be specified that each spike 9 serves to improve the adherence of the footwear element 1 on slippery ground, made of snow or ice.
- rod 4 comprises a first portion or lower portion 11, provided to surround the foot via the shoe 2.
- the upper 4 of the footwear element 1 comprises an upper portion 12 which extends the lower portion 11 in a direction away from the outer sole 3, the upper portion 12 being provided to cover at least the ankle of the user, or the ankle and part of the lower leg.
- the upper portion 12 of the rod 4 increases the outer surface of the footwear element 1, with respect to an element whose stem only comprises a low portion.
- the upper portion 12 of the upper 4 also increases the amount of footwear and protection of the footwear element.
- the specific properties of the lower portion 11 of the rod such as water or snowtightness, or thermal insulation, are extended by the upper portion 12.
- these are at the same time the foot , the ankle and part of the lower leg that are protected. Water, snow or ice can hardly penetrate, if at all, inside the footwear element 1.
- the boot 2 is therefore also protected.
- the shoe 2 comprises an outer sole 13 and a flexible upper 14.
- the shoe 2 extends in length from a rear end or heel 15 to a front end or tip 16, and in width between a side portion 17 and a medial portion 18.
- the shoe 2 comprises a lower portion 19 to the exclusion of any high portion.
- the shoe 2 extends in height from the outer sole 13 to an upper end 20, that is to say to the free end of the lower portion 19 or the rod 14.
- the footwear element 1 extends in height from the outer soleing 3 to an upper end 21, that is to say up to the free end of the upper portion 12 or the rod 4
- the upper end 20 of the rod 14 is closer to the outer sole 3 than is the upper end 21. This reflects the fact that the stem 4 of the footwear item 1 extends the cover obtained by the upper 14 of the shoe 2.
- the lower portion 11 and the upper portion 12 of the footwear element 1 form a continuous envelope. This means that no passage remains for the intrusion of foreign bodies. This also means that the protection provided by the flexible rod 4 extends both at the lower portion 11 and at the upper portion 12.
- the footwear element 1 has a boot opening 25.
- This 25 extends from the upper end 21 towards the rear end 5, at the level of the outer sole 3.
- the opening 25 has an upper subdivision 26 for passing the foot, and also to surround the lower leg after footwear.
- the boot opening 25 of the flexible rod 4 has a lower subdivision 27 which allows a variation in size of the opening and the volume of footwear.
- the subdivisions upper 26 and lower 27 extend one another. This arrangement allows the introduction of the shoe 2 in the footwear element 1, or its withdrawal. By corollary the arrangement above allows the introduction or withdrawal of the foot, at the same time as the shoe.
- the footwear element 1 also comprises closing means 28 of the lower subdivision 27 of the boot opening 25. This keeps the upper 4 in contact with the boot 2 on the one hand, and in contact with the ankle and the bottom leg on the other hand.
- closure means 28 comprise a slideway 29.
- the latter allows a quick opening or closing of the lower subdivision 27, which saves time for shoeing or loosening.
- other structures of closure means are possible, such as a lace device, a device with complementary bands, one of which is provided with loops and the other of hooks, or any equivalent means.
- the lower subdivision 27 of the boot opening 25 is disposed at the rear of the rod. This facilitates the donning of the footwear element 1 by a foot already covered with the shoe. Another benefit is a better resistance to the penetration of foreign bodies, especially in snowy conditions. Indeed, because the lower subdivision 27 is located at the rear, the front face 30 of the rod 4 is continuous from the front end 6 to the upper end 21. In other words, the front face does not show any passage. Now the march is translated by advances and contacts of the rod 4 with the snow on the side of this face. Its continuity of structure is a pledge of sealing and / or protection.
- the footwear element 1 also comprises clamping means 31, 32, 33 of the rod 4.
- the clamping means comprise straps, for example a front strap 31 located at the metatarsal level, a low rear strap 32 located in the region of the instep region, as well as a high rear strap 33, located at the upper end 21.
- Each strap can be tightened or loosened, so as to adjust the volume of the footwear element 1. It is thus possible to better press the footwear element 1 on the shoe 2 and on the lower leg. This results in a more precise application of the outer sole 3 of the footwear element 1 on the outer sole 13 of the boot 2. As a result, the stability of the tips 9 is increased, and the transmission of the pulses or sensory information related to walking or the race is more accurate. The perception of proprioceptive information is increased.
- the outer soleing 3 of the footwear element 1 is flexible, in the sense that it allows a flexion or unwinding of the foot during walking, as is understood by means of the figure 4 .
- the outer soleing 3 comprises for example one or more layers of synthetic material. Without limitation, it may be provided a layer of material such as a polyurethane, whose thickness is between 3 and 7 mm.
- the footwear element 1 comprises a rear cleat 41 and a front cleat 42.
- the rear cleat 41 is located at the heel, near the rear end 5, while the front cleat 42 is located at the level of the toes and metatarsal, near the front end 6.
- the outer sole 3, and also the entire footwear element 1 consequently, retains good bending or unwinding ability. This makes walking or running easier.
- the rear spike 41 comprises a body 43 and spikes 9, and the front spike 42 comprises a body 44 and spikes 9. More generally here each spike 41, 42 comprises a body 43, 44 disposed on the side of the outer face 10 of the spine. external sole 3. This facilitates the manufacture of the footwear element 1, in the sense that the establishment of the cleats on the outer sole 3 is easy.
- the footwear element 1 comprises fastening means 45 which allow permanent fastening of each crampon 41, 42 to the outer sole 3. These means are for example constituted by rivets 45 which hold each body 43, 44 to contact of the external face 10 of the outer sole 3.
- fastening means 45 which allow permanent fastening of each crampon 41, 42 to the outer sole 3.
- These means are for example constituted by rivets 45 which hold each body 43, 44 to contact of the external face 10 of the outer sole 3.
- the front spike 42 comprises a transverse articulation 46 which connects two subdivisions 47, 48 of the body 44 to one another. More specifically, the spike 42 comprises a rear subdivision 47 and a front subdivision 48, the subdivisions being articulated with respect to each other. This allows the body to follow bending deformations of the outer sole 3 at the front of the footwear element 1.
- the footwear element 1 comprises a single crampon 51.
- the latter extends along a length comprised between 70 and 100% of the length of the outer sole 3, and comprises by example, a rear subdivision 52 and a front subdivision 53, both provided with points 9, and a bridge 54 which connects the subdivisions to one another.
- This single crampon 51 stiffens the outer sole 3, which gives the latter a certain torsional resistance along a longitudinal axis of the footwear element, and / or a certain flexural strength along a transverse axis of the footwear element.
- the second embodiment corresponds to a footwear element well adapted to the evolution on the ice.
- a footwear element 1 with an outer sole 3 and a flexible upper 4.
- the footwear element 1 also comprises a spike 61, which itself comprises a rear subdivision 62 and a front subdivision 63, both provided with spikes. 9, and a bridge 64 which connects the subdivisions to one another.
- the crampon 61 is adjustable in length. This allows it to be used for footwear of different sizes.
- each crampon 61 comprises a body 65, 66 disposed on the side of an inner face 67 of the outer sole 3. More precisely here the rear subdivision 62 of the crampon 61 comprises a body 65, and the front subdivision 63 comprises a body 66.
- the inner face of the outer sole 3 is opposite to the outer face 10 and, therefore, is turned towards the shoe 2 when it is housed in the footwear element . It is observed that the tips 9 protrude with respect to the outer face 10, crossing the thickness of the outer sole 3 from the inner face 67. orifices 68 in the form of points 9 are provided for this purpose. In fact the crampon 61 is put in place by being introduced inside the footwear element 1, points oriented towards the outer sole 3.
- a thrust for example manual, causes the spikes 9 to pass through the sole 3 through the holes 68. Then, during use, the shoe 2 holds the crampon (s) in place. Of course, each body 65, 66 is then held between the outer sole 3 of the footwear element and the outer sole 13 of the boot 2. This arrangement allows easy disassembly of the footwear element 1.
- the invention covers an assembly comprising a low-stemmed shoe 2 and a footwear element 1.
